Trammps (album)
1975 studio album by The Trammps From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

The Trammps is the debut album by American soul-disco group, The Trammps, released in April 1975 through Golden Fleece Records.

Commercial performance
The album peaked at No. 30 on the R&B albums chart. It also reached No. 159 on the Billboard 200. The album features the singles "Love Epidemic", which peaked at No. 75 on the Hot Soul Singles chart, "Where Do We Go from Here", which charted at No. 44 on the Hot Soul Singles chart, and "Trusting Heart", which reached No. 72 on the Hot Soul Singles chart. "Where Do We Go From Here" was the last song played on closing night of New York's legendary disco Paradise Garage.

Personnel
- Dennis Harris – lead guitar
- Jimmy Ellis – lead vocal
- Michael Thompson – drums
- Earl Young – drums, vocal
- Doc Wade – guitar, vocal
- Stan Wade – bass, vocal
- John Hart – organ, vocal
- Ron Kersey – piano, vocal
- Roger Stevens – trumpet
- John Davis – saxophone
- Fred Jointer – trombone
- MFSB – music
